Could you concisely define "embedded system design" off the top of your head? This article looks at the essential characteristics of an increasingly prominent…
Could you concisely define "embedded system design" off the top of your head? This article looks at the essential characteristics of an increasingly prominent specialization within the field of electrical engineering.
This article will look at some of the consequences of adding a reset input to an FPGA design.
This article will look at some of the consequences of adding a reset input to an FPGA design.
This article explores the schematic design and basic features of a smart programmable wireless controller module I…
This article explores the schematic design and basic features of a smart programmable wireless controller module I designed: the WiCard.
This article will review considerations for efficient FPGA implementation of symmetric FIR filters.
This article will review considerations for efficient FPGA implementation of symmetric FIR filters.
This article will review a basic algorithm for binary division.
This article will review a basic algorithm for binary division.
This article will review integrating a Xilinx IP core into an FPGA design.
This article will review integrating a Xilinx IP core into an FPGA design.
This article demonstrates a solderless-breadboard compatible carrier-board for a pre-certified BLE4 or BLE5 module made…
This article demonstrates a solderless-breadboard compatible carrier-board for a pre-certified BLE4 or BLE5 module made by GT-Tronics. Use it to experiment with your own BLE5 compatible designs.
Use a Honeywell particle sensor to measure 2.5 µm PM and 10.0 µm PM concentrations in your environment.
Use a Honeywell particle sensor to measure 2.5 µm PM and 10.0 µm PM concentrations in your environment.
This article will review different encoding methods that can be used to implement the states of an FSM.
This article will review different encoding methods that can be used to implement the states of an FSM.
This article discusses implementation details for a simple yet effective technique that can improve your digital communication.
This article discusses implementation details for a simple yet effective technique that can improve your digital communication.
In this article we’ll discuss the design for a custom microcontroller programming/debug/extension PCB and we’ll look…
In this article we’ll discuss the design for a custom microcontroller programming/debug/extension PCB and we’ll look at an example project.
This article provides a closer look at the PCB design considerations and programming of a custom capacitive touch…
This article provides a closer look at the PCB design considerations and programming of a custom capacitive touch interface device.
This article covers the various roadblocks encountered in a new design and how they were troubleshot and overcome.
This article covers the various roadblocks encountered in a new design and how they were troubleshot and overcome.
This article will review the "std_logic_vector" data type which is one of the most common data types in VHDL.
This article will review the "std_logic_vector" data type which is one of the most common data types in VHDL.
This is a protoype of a fitness wearable device designed to vibrate when it detects stagnation.
This is a protoype of a fitness wearable device designed to vibrate when it detects stagnation.
This article explains the Look-Up Tables (LUTs) constituting Field Programmable Gate Arrays (FPGAs).
This article explains the Look-Up Tables (LUTs) constituting Field Programmable Gate Arrays (FPGAs).
A Picaxe 08M2 microcontroller and an HIH6030 sensor team up to easily control a ventilation fan using temperature or…
A Picaxe 08M2 microcontroller and an HIH6030 sensor team up to easily control a ventilation fan using temperature or humidity or both.
This article provides detailed information on sampling audio signals and transferring the data to a PC for analysis.
This article provides detailed information on sampling audio signals and transferring the data to a PC for analysis.
Bluetooth LE was designed with the IoT in mind. Here are some options for troubleshooting your next Bluetooth LE project.
Bluetooth LE was designed with the IoT in mind. Here are some options for troubleshooting your next Bluetooth LE project.
Learn how to implement a moving average filter and optimize it with CIC architecture.
Learn how to implement a moving average filter and optimize it with CIC architecture.